Volleyball Recap: Riverheads Gladiators vs. Waynesboro Little Giants
Riverheads needed a changed in momentum after dropping five straight games and they got it from Hattie Croft. The Riverheads Gladiators had just enough and edged the Waynesboro Little Giants out 3-2 on Tuesday thanks in part to Croft, who had ten digs and two aces. That's the most aces she has posted in her last seven matches.
Riverheads was staring down a 2-1 deficit headed into the fourth set, but they rallied to take the next two for the win. The match finished with set scores of 25-21, 23-25, 21-25, 25-21, 16-14.
Gwyneth Lloyd paced Riverheads' offense, picking up 14 kills. Lloyd got some help from
Kylee Swats and her 36 assists. Swats was also solid from the service line: she led the team with five aces.
Riverheads' victory ended a six-game drought on the road and puts them at 7-12. As for Waynesboro, this is the second loss in a row for them and nudges their season record down to 14-9.
Riverheads has already played their next matchup, a 3-0 defeat against Staunton on the 30th. Waynesboro does not have any more games scheduled as of now.
